Organize their Clothing with Dot Method
If you have more than one child, identifying their clothing can be confusing. The dot method is an ideal solution in such cases. Simply mark two dots for the second child, three dots for the third child, and so on. This tip is simple, but it can save you lots of time when sorting out the laundry.
Inflatable Pool as a Playpen
Most babies will only use a playpen for a few months. Purchasing one is quite a waste of money. Instead, you can use the family’s inflatable pool as a playpen for your baby. It will not only save money but also serve the purpose without taking any extra space.

Monster Spray for Scary Nights
Sometimes children get scared of monsters in the night time. Making “monster spray” by adding monster stickers to a bottle filled with water is a fun solution to get rid of the monsters. It’s a genius idea that will ease your child’s fear and make bedtime much more comfortable.

Temporary Tattoos for Reclaiming Lost Children
One of the most frightening things for parents is when their child gets lost. Creating temporary tattoos with your telephone number is an excellent way to ensure that you can reclaim your child if they get lost during an outing.

Pool Noodles as Door Stoppers
Kids often catch their fingers in the door, and it can be quite painful. Buying a pool noodle and cutting a wedge to insert in the door frame can prevent this from happening. It’s an inexpensive and easy solution to protect your child’s fingers.
Lotion Bottles as Faucet Extenders
Turning an old lotion bottle into a faucet extender is a great idea. It allows children to wash their hands on their own, promoting their independence. It also saves you time as you can get other tasks done instead of constantly assisting your child.
Laundry Basket to Keep Bath Toys in Place
Children like to play with their toys in the bath, and sometimes they end up floating away. Using a laundry basket is an easy solution to this problem, as it keeps the toys in place and reduces the risk of your child falling over while reaching for a toy.
